Hactool Prod.keys Does Not Exist -
: Re-verify that you are using the -k parameter correctly or that the file is in the exact default folder path ( ~/.switch/prod.keys or %USERPROFILE%\.switch\prod.keys ).
The prod.keys file contains copyrighted Nintendo proprietary data. We cannot provide a link to download this file. You must generate it yourself from your own Nintendo Switch console.
prod.keys is the critical key file that hactool needs to decrypt encrypted Switch content. It contains console-specific cryptographic keys derived from your device. hactool prod.keys does not exist
Let’s break down exactly why this error happens, what you need to do to fix it, and how to get hactool running smoothly. Understanding the Error: What Are prod.keys ?
The "hactool prod.keys does not exist" error occurs due to the following reasons: : Re-verify that you are using the -k
Put your Switch into RCM mode and inject the payload using TegraRCMGUI, a web injector, or a hardware dongle.
“After dumping my own keys, hactool works perfectly. The error is a safety feature to prevent misuse.” – ★★★★★ You must generate it yourself from your own
: Place them at $HOME/.switch/prod.keys —this allows you to use hactool freely from anywhere without worrying about where your keyfile is.
The simplest fix is to place your prod.keys file into the exact same folder where your hactool.exe executable is located. When you run a command inside that directory, hactool looks locally first. Option B: The Default Home Directory (Best for Global Use)
You get 100% accurate keys for your specific console firmware version, and you avoid legal risks associated with downloading keys from the internet.